A very heavy, rounded serif with compact proportions and soft, bulb-like terminals. Serifs are prominent and strongly bracketed, often curling into teardrop and hook shapes that give the strokes a sculpted, almost carved feel. Counters are relatively small and tight at this weight, with generously rounded joins and a gentle, slightly irregular rhythm that feels intentionally decorative rather than strictly geometric. The overall silhouette is bouncy and high-contrast in shape (more by mass and swelling than by sharp hairlines), producing sturdy letterforms with a lively, animated edge.

Best suited to display sizes where the curled serifs and rounded terminals can read clearly—headlines, poster work, packaging, and logo wordmarks. It can also work for short passages such as pull quotes or titles, but the dense weight and tight counters suggest avoiding long body text or very small sizes.

The font reads cheerful and nostalgic, evoking poster lettering and storybook display type. Its rounded, swashy serif behavior adds a humorous, slightly quirky tone that feels welcoming rather than formal. The dense black color and soft curves also give it a cozy, handcrafted warmth suited to characterful branding.

The design appears aimed at delivering strong impact with a friendly, decorative serif voice—prioritizing personality and a distinctive silhouette over restraint. Its consistent, chunky construction and playful serif flourishes suggest a deliberate attempt to channel vintage display typography in a modern, highly legible way at larger sizes.

Uppercase forms maintain strong presence with pronounced, curling serif details, while lowercase shapes stay wide and friendly with prominent bowls and ear-like terminals in several letters. Numerals are equally weighty and decorative, matching the overall bounce and maintaining consistent, chunky color across the set.
